πŸ” What This Code Means

Modern engines use a system called Variable Valve Timing (VVT) β€” sometimes called VVT-i, VANOS, CVVT, or i-VTEC depending on the manufacturer. It works by adjusting the position of the camshaft relative to the crankshaft using oil pressure. The result is better power at high RPM and better efficiency at low RPM. It's a clever system β€” when it's working.

P0011 means the ECM (your engine's computer) commanded the intake camshaft on Bank 1 to move to a specific position, but the camshaft went too far in the "advanced" direction β€” or went there when it shouldn't have. The ECM detects this by comparing signals from the crankshaft position sensor and the camshaft position sensor.

πŸ’‘ "Advanced" means the camshaft is rotated forward so valves open earlier than commanded. "Retarded" means valves open later. Both cause performance problems β€” P0011 is specifically the over-advanced condition.

The VVT system runs entirely on oil pressure. That means dirty oil, low oil level, or a stuck oil control solenoid is suspect #1 β€” not a mechanical timing failure. Roughly half of all P0011 cases are solved without any parts replacement at all.

⚑ Common Symptoms

P0011 symptoms can range from barely noticeable to impossible to ignore. The engine may run surprisingly well at some speeds and fall apart at others.

Rough idle or stalling
The engine stumbles, shakes, or dies at idle β€” especially when first started or after the engine reaches operating temperature.
Hard cold starts
The engine cranks much longer than usual on cold mornings. Over-advanced timing disrupts the precise valve timing needed for a quick cold start.
Loss of power under load
Noticeable hesitation or power drop when accelerating onto the highway or climbing a hill. The engine feels sluggish and unresponsive.
Poor fuel economy
Incorrect valve timing prevents the combustion cycle from completing efficiently. MPG drops, sometimes significantly, over several tanks.
Engine rattling on startup
A brief ticking or rattling sound when the engine first starts, then disappears after a few seconds. This is the VVT system struggling with dirty or low oil.
Check engine light only
On some vehicles, especially newer ones, P0011 produces no obvious drivability symptoms at first. The light is the only warning before things get worse.
🎯 Most Likely Causes

Listed from most common to least common. Start at #1 every time β€” the majority of P0011 cases are solved before reaching cause #4.

1
Dirty or degraded engine oilThe VVT system is entirely oil-pressure driven. Dirty, sludgy, or low oil cannot move the camshaft phaser accurately. This is by far the most common cause β€” especially on vehicles that are overdue for an oil change or have been run on the wrong viscosity. Always check this first.
~ 38% of cases
2
Stuck or clogged VVT oil control solenoid (Bank 1)The VVT solenoid is a small electrically controlled valve that directs oil flow to the camshaft phaser. Oil sludge buildup causes it to stick in the open position, which locks the camshaft in the advanced position. Cleaning or replacing the solenoid is a straightforward job on most engines.
~ 30% of cases
3
Faulty camshaft phaser (VVT actuator)The phaser is the mechanical component bolted to the camshaft that physically changes its position. Internal wear or seal failure causes it to stick in the advanced position regardless of solenoid commands. More likely on high-mileage engines that have been run on degraded oil for extended periods.
~ 14% of cases
4
Stretched or worn timing chainA stretched timing chain introduces slack that changes the effective camshaft position. The ECM sees the camshaft in the advanced position even when the solenoid is not commanding it. Usually accompanied by a rattling or slapping noise from the front of the engine, most noticeably on cold starts.
~ 10% of cases
5
Wiring fault β€” solenoid connector or circuitA shorted, open, or corroded wiring connector to the VVT solenoid can supply constant voltage, holding it open and keeping the camshaft advanced. Wiggling the connector with the engine running will sometimes cause the symptom to come and go, confirming an electrical fault.
~ 5% of cases
6
Failed camshaft or crankshaft position sensorP0011 is generated by comparing signals from both sensors. If either sensor gives inaccurate readings, the ECM can see a false over-advanced condition. This is rarely the root cause on its own β€” look for additional camshaft/crankshaft sensor codes if this is suspected.
~ 3% of cases
πŸ”§ What to Check First

Do these three checks before spending any money. They take about 30 minutes and require no special tools. Between them, they solve P0011 in the majority of cases.

1
Check oil level and condition immediatelyPull the dipstick. Oil should sit between the MIN and MAX marks. Then look at the oil on the dipstick β€” healthy oil is amber to light brown. Dark brown or black oil that smells burnt is overdue for a change. Check your owner's manual for the correct viscosity grade (commonly 5W-20, 5W-30, or 0W-20). Running the wrong viscosity is a surprisingly common cause of VVT codes. If oil is dark or overdue, do a full oil and filter change before anything else β€” clear the code and drive 50 miles.
2
Inspect and clean the VVT solenoidThe solenoid is typically located on the front of the cylinder head, near the camshaft sprocket β€” one bolt holds it in place. Remove it and inspect the screen filter on the end. A clogged screen coated in sludge is a direct sign that oil quality has been the problem. Clean it with parts cleaner, allow it to dry completely, reinstall, and retest. If cleaning does not resolve the code, replace the solenoid β€” it is a relatively inexpensive part on most applications.
3
Listen for timing chain noise at cold startStart the engine cold and immediately listen from the front of the engine for a brief rattle or slapping sound that disappears after a few seconds. This is the classic sign of a stretched timing chain. If you hear it consistently, especially if it takes longer than 2–3 seconds to go away, the timing chain tensioner or chain itself is likely worn. This requires a shop inspection β€” do not ignore a persistent cold-start rattle.

⚠️ Common Misdiagnosis

P0011 has a reputation for triggering expensive repair recommendations that aren't necessary. These three are the most frequent β€” and the most avoidable.

⚠ Misdiagnosis #1 β€” Timing chain replacement recommended before checking oil and solenoid
A timing chain job is a multi-hour repair with significant parts and labor costs. Yet P0011 is set far more often by dirty oil and a gummed-up solenoid than by actual chain wear. Any shop recommending timing chain replacement before first performing an oil change, cleaning the solenoid, and retesting is skipping the diagnostic process entirely. Insist on those steps first.
Potential savings: Very significant β€” a simple oil service versus a major engine job
⚠ Misdiagnosis #2 β€” New VVT solenoid sold before cleaning the existing one
A solenoid clogged with oil sludge and a genuinely failed solenoid produce identical codes. The correct first step is always to remove and clean the solenoid (particularly its filter screen), reinstall it, clear the code, and drive at least 50 miles before evaluating. Replacement makes sense only after cleaning has failed. If a shop quotes you a new solenoid without mentioning cleaning, ask why they're skipping that step.
Potential savings: Cleaning vs. full solenoid replacement cost
⚠ Misdiagnosis #3 β€” Camshaft phaser replaced without verifying oil pressure
A worn phaser does cause P0011, but it almost always fails because it has been starved of clean oil for too long. Replacing the phaser without also addressing oil quality and solenoid condition will result in the new phaser failing in the same way β€” often within a year. The correct approach is to restore clean oil circulation first, verify solenoid function, then assess the phaser if the problem persists.
Potential savings: Avoids a repeat repair at significant expense

❓ Frequently Asked Questions
Can I drive with P0011 active?
Short, necessary trips only β€” not regular commuting. Over-advanced camshaft timing puts the engine's valve events out of sync, which increases heat and internal wear. On interference engines β€” where pistons and valves share the same space at different times β€” severe over-advance can lead to contact between the two. Get this diagnosed within a few days, not a few weeks.
Will an oil change fix P0011?
Yes β€” in many cases it does. Dirty or degraded oil is the leading cause of P0011 because the entire variable valve timing system depends on clean oil pressure to move the camshaft phaser accurately. Fresh oil at the correct viscosity (check your owner's manual β€” using the wrong grade is a surprisingly common cause) often clears the code within a few drive cycles. It is always worth trying before spending anything else.
What is a VVT solenoid and where is it located?
The Variable Valve Timing solenoid is an oil control valve β€” usually a cylindrical component about the size of a thick pen, threaded directly into the engine block or cylinder head near the camshaft. It controls oil flow to the camshaft phaser by opening and closing based on ECM commands. On most engines it is visible with the engine cover removed, held in by a single bolt. A small wiring connector plugs into one end.
If P0011 and P0021 appear together, what does that mean?
P0021 is the same over-advanced camshaft fault on Bank 2. Both codes appearing together means both intake camshafts are stuck advanced β€” which strongly points to a system-wide oil pressure or oil quality problem rather than individual solenoid failures. Start with a full oil change using the manufacturer-specified viscosity before replacing any parts. Both codes should clear together if oil quality was the cause.
How long can I wait before repairing P0011?
Do not delay more than a couple of days of regular driving. Over-advanced timing increases heat and valve train stress with every drive. The good news is that the first two checks β€” an oil change and solenoid inspection β€” can be done in under an hour and cost very little. There is no good reason to keep driving on a P0011 when the cheapest possible fix is also the most likely one.
